Now after one year or so, "Pookoo" has reached close to 2,000 readers in 15 countries. The story is about an Olympic athlete and how life is after losing gold at the Olympic Games and becomes a celebrity all over again. People are asking if there will be a sequel or a trilogy.
With Shiloh's plan for worldwide distribution revving up and taking off, he knows that those readers will expect something again. The plan is to tell compelling stories that have quirkiness, humor and a meaning of life aspect to them. In other words, continue with what "Pookoo" promised.
SHILOH STARTS LITERACY BENEFIT ON FACEBOOK
Recently, Shiloh started a literacy donation program for a Chicago literacy program through his Facebook page (http://apps.facebook.com/
"My grandparents had to work at a very young age and my grandfather couldn't read more than headlines," Shiloh reveals. "It stuns me that wouldn't have been able to read my novels."
So Shiloh began the "Lenny the Lobster's Pookoo Improve Adult Literacy Group" on Facebook, which will benefit a Chicago literacy group.
